SSL Certificates Explained: Securing Your Domain the Right Way

In today’s digital landscape, where cyber threats are increasingly sophisticated and data breaches make headlines regularly, securing web communications has become paramount for businesses and individuals alike. SSL certificates represent one of the most fundamental security measures for protecting online interactions, yet many website owners remain uncertain about their implementation, types, and best practices. Understanding SSL certificates and their proper deployment is crucial for maintaining user trust, protecting sensitive information, and ensuring compliance with modern security standards.

The evolution of web security has transformed SSL certificates from optional enhancements to essential requirements. Search engines now favour HTTPS-secured websites in rankings, browsers display prominent warnings for unencrypted sites, and users have become increasingly security-conscious about sharing personal information online. This shift has made SSL certificate implementation not merely a technical consideration but a business necessity that impacts visibility, credibility, and commercial success.

Understanding SSL Certificates and Their Purpose

SSL (Secure Sockets Layer) certificates, now more accurately referred to as TLS (Transport Layer Security) certificates, serve as digital passports that establish secure, encrypted connections between web browsers and servers. These certificates facilitate the creation of an encrypted tunnel through which sensitive data can travel safely, protected from interception, manipulation, or eavesdropping by malicious parties.

The fundamental purpose of SSL certificates extends beyond simple encryption. They provide authentication, ensuring users that they are connecting to legitimate websites rather than fraudulent imposters. This authentication mechanism helps prevent man-in-the-middle attacks, where attackers intercept communications by positioning themselves between users and intended destinations.

SSL certificates also ensure data integrity, guaranteeing that information transmitted between browsers and servers remains unchanged during transit. This integrity verification prevents tampering and ensures that users receive exactly what was sent by legitimate servers, maintaining the accuracy and reliability of web communications.

The certificate authority (CA) system underpins SSL certificate trustworthiness. These authoritative organisations verify domain ownership and, depending on certificate type, organisational legitimacy before issuing certificates. Major certificate authorities maintain root certificates embedded within browsers and operating systems, enabling automatic trust verification without user intervention.

Types of SSL Certificates: Choosing the Right Protection

SSL certificates come in various types, each designed to meet specific security requirements and validation levels. Understanding these distinctions helps organisations select appropriate certificates that balance security needs with budget considerations and implementation complexity.

Domain Validated (DV) certificates represent the most basic SSL certificate type, requiring only verification of domain ownership. The validation process typically involves responding to automated emails or creating specific DNS records, making DV certificates quick and inexpensive to obtain. These certificates provide encryption but offer limited assurance about organisation legitimacy, making them suitable for basic websites, blogs, and non-commercial applications.

Organisation Validated (OV) certificates require more extensive verification, including confirmation of organisation existence and legitimacy. Certificate authorities perform business registration checks, verify contact information, and may conduct telephone verification before issuing OV certificates. These certificates display organisation information within certificate details, providing enhanced credibility for business websites.

Extended Validation (EV) certificates represent the highest validation level, requiring comprehensive verification of organisation identity, physical existence, and operational legitimacy. The rigorous validation process includes legal existence verification, operational presence confirmation, and authoritative contact validation. EV certificates traditionally displayed green address bars in browsers, though modern browsers have moved away from this visual indicator whilst maintaining the underlying security benefits.

Wildcard certificates provide coverage for unlimited subdomains under a primary domain, offering cost-effective solutions for organisations managing multiple subdomains. These certificates secure the primary domain and all first-level subdomains, simplifying certificate management whilst providing comprehensive coverage.

Multi-domain certificates, also known as Subject Alternative Name (SAN) certificates, secure multiple distinct domains within a single certificate. These certificates prove particularly useful for organisations managing diverse web properties or requiring flexible domain coverage without purchasing separate certificates for each domain.

The SSL Certificate Validation Process

Understanding the SSL certificate validation process helps organisations prepare for certificate acquisition and ensures smooth implementation. The validation process varies significantly depending on certificate type, with more secure certificates requiring extensive verification procedures.

Domain validation involves proving control over the domain for which the certificate is requested. Common validation methods include email validation, where certificate authorities send verification emails to standard administrative addresses associated with the domain. Recipients must respond to these emails or click verification links to confirm domain control.

DNS validation requires creating specific DNS records containing validation tokens provided by certificate authorities. This method offers advantages for domains where email validation proves problematic, such as internal domains or situations where standard administrative email addresses are unavailable.

File-based validation involves uploading specific files containing validation tokens to designated locations on web servers. Certificate authorities then verify these files’ presence and content to confirm domain control. This method requires server access but provides reliable validation for most standard configurations.

Organisation validation extends beyond domain control to encompass business legitimacy verification. Certificate authorities consult business registries, verify registration documents, and may contact organisations directly to confirm operational status and certificate request legitimacy.

Extended validation requires the most comprehensive verification process, including legal opinion letters, operational confirmation, and extensive documentation review. This process typically takes longer than other validation types but provides the highest assurance level for certificate recipients.

Certificate Installation and Configuration

Proper SSL certificate installation requires careful attention to technical details and server-specific requirements. The installation process varies depending on server software, hosting environment, and certificate format, making understanding of these variations essential for successful implementation.

Certificate file formats play a crucial role in installation success. PEM format certificates use base64 encoding with distinctive header and footer markers, making them human-readable and widely compatible with various server software. DER format certificates use binary encoding, requiring specific software support but offering compact file sizes.

PKCS#12 format bundles certificates with private keys in password-protected files, simplifying distribution whilst maintaining security. P7B format contains certificates and intermediate certificates but excludes private keys, making it suitable for situations requiring certificate chain distribution without key exposure.

Private key management represents a critical security consideration during installation. Private keys must remain confidential and stored securely on servers requiring certificate functionality. Key compromise necessitates immediate certificate revocation and replacement to maintain security integrity.

Intermediate certificate installation ensures complete certificate chain validation. Many certificate authorities issue certificates signed by intermediate certificates rather than root certificates directly. Installing complete certificate chains prevents validation errors and ensures compatibility across all browsers and operating systems.

Server-specific installation procedures vary considerably between different web server software. Apache installations typically require certificate and key file references within virtual host configurations, whilst Nginx requires similar file references within server blocks. IIS installations often involve certificate store management through administrative interfaces.

SSL Certificate Management and Renewal

Effective SSL certificate management extends beyond initial installation to encompass ongoing monitoring, renewal planning, and lifecycle management. Organisations must implement systematic approaches to prevent certificate expiry incidents that can disrupt services and damage user confidence.

Certificate monitoring systems track expiry dates, validation status, and certificate health across organisational web properties. Automated monitoring tools can provide advance warnings of approaching expiry dates, certificate revocation events, and configuration issues that might impact certificate functionality.

Renewal planning should account for certificate authority validation requirements, potential delays in verification processes, and coordination needs for certificate deployment across multiple servers or services. Planning renewal activities well in advance of expiry dates prevents last-minute complications and ensures service continuity.

Automated renewal systems, such as those provided by Let’s Encrypt and other certificate authorities, can eliminate manual renewal processes whilst ensuring certificates remain current. These systems typically use API-based validation and automated deployment to maintain certificate validity without human intervention.

Certificate inventory management becomes crucial for organisations operating multiple domains or complex web infrastructures. Maintaining comprehensive records of certificate details, expiry dates, validation levels, and deployment locations helps prevent oversights and ensures consistent security coverage.

Backup and recovery procedures should address certificate and private key protection, ensuring that security credentials remain available during system failures or migration activities. Secure backup storage prevents key compromise whilst ensuring availability when needed for recovery operations.

Common SSL Implementation Challenges and Solutions

SSL certificate implementation frequently encounters various technical challenges that can impede successful deployment or compromise security effectiveness. Understanding these common issues and their solutions helps organisations avoid pitfalls and maintain robust security configurations.

Mixed content warnings occur when HTTPS pages load resources such as images, scripts, or stylesheets over HTTP connections. Browsers treat these situations as security risks and may block content loading or display warning messages. Resolving mixed content requires updating all resource references to use HTTPS URLs or protocol-relative URLs that adapt to page protocol automatically.

Certificate chain issues represent another common challenge, occurring when intermediate certificates are missing or incorrectly configured. Incomplete certificate chains prevent proper validation and may cause browser warnings or connection failures. Tools such as SSL Labs’ Server Test can identify chain issues and provide guidance for resolution.

Cipher suite configuration affects both security and compatibility, requiring balance between strong encryption and broad browser support. Modern configurations should prioritise strong ciphers whilst maintaining compatibility with supported browser versions. Regular updates to cipher suite configurations help address newly discovered vulnerabilities whilst maintaining security effectiveness.

Protocol version compatibility presents ongoing challenges as older SSL/TLS versions become deprecated due to security vulnerabilities. Organisations must balance security requirements with compatibility needs, gradually phasing out support for obsolete protocols whilst maintaining service availability for legitimate users.

Load balancer and CDN integration introduces complexity for SSL certificate deployment across distributed infrastructures. These environments require careful planning for certificate distribution, private key protection, and configuration consistency across multiple endpoints.

Advanced SSL Configuration and Security Hardening

Beyond basic SSL certificate installation, advanced configuration techniques enhance security posture and provide additional protection against sophisticated attacks. These measures represent best practices for organisations requiring enhanced security or operating in high-risk environments.

HTTP Strict Transport Security (HSTS) headers instruct browsers to enforce HTTPS connections for specified periods, preventing downgrade attacks and ensuring encrypted communications even when users attempt HTTP connections. HSTS preloading extends this protection by incorporating domains into browser preload lists, providing protection from the first visit.

Certificate pinning techniques bind specific certificates or certificate authorities to particular domains, preventing acceptance of fraudulent certificates even when issued by trusted authorities. Public Key Pinning (HPKP) headers implement browser-based pinning, though this technique requires careful implementation to avoid service disruption.

Perfect Forward Secrecy (PFS) configuration ensures that compromised private keys cannot decrypt previously captured communications. Implementing cipher suites that support PFS provides additional protection against retroactive decryption attacks, enhancing long-term security for sensitive communications.

Session security enhancements include secure session token generation, appropriate session timeout configuration, and secure cookie attributes that prevent session hijacking attacks. These measures complement SSL protection by securing session management mechanisms.

Certificate transparency monitoring helps detect unauthorised certificate issuance by monitoring public certificate logs maintained by major certificate authorities. Automated monitoring can alert organisations to suspicious certificate activity that might indicate compromise or fraud attempts.

SSL Certificate Costs and Budget Considerations

SSL certificate costs vary significantly based on validation level, features, and certificate authority selection. Understanding cost structures helps organisations make informed decisions that balance security requirements with budgetary constraints whilst avoiding unnecessary expenses.

Domain Validated certificates represent the most cost-effective option, with prices ranging from free (Let’s Encrypt) to modest annual fees for commercial providers. These certificates provide adequate security for basic websites whilst minimising costs for organisations with simple requirements.

Organisation Validated certificates command higher prices due to enhanced validation requirements and increased assurance levels. Costs typically range from moderate annual fees to higher prices for premium providers, reflecting the additional verification work required for issuance.

Extended Validation certificates represent the highest-cost option, with prices reflecting comprehensive validation procedures and premium assurance levels. Whilst expensive, EV certificates may provide value for high-profile organisations where trust and credibility represent critical business factors.

Wildcard and multi-domain certificates often provide cost advantages for organisations managing multiple domains or subdomains. Comparing per-domain costs against individual certificate purchases helps identify cost-effective solutions for complex requirements.

Certificate authority selection impacts both cost and features, with established providers often charging premium prices whilst newer providers may offer competitive pricing to gain market share. Balancing cost considerations with reliability, support quality, and feature requirements ensures appropriate provider selection.

Compliance and Regulatory Considerations

SSL certificate implementation increasingly intersects with various compliance frameworks and regulatory requirements that mandate encryption for sensitive data transmission. Understanding these requirements helps organisations ensure compliance whilst avoiding potential penalties or audit failures.

Payment Card Industry Data Security Standard (PCI DSS) requirements mandate strong cryptography for cardholder data transmission over public networks. SSL certificate implementation represents a fundamental component of PCI DSS compliance, with specific requirements for cipher strengths, protocol versions, and certificate management procedures.

General Data Protection Regulation (GDPR) emphasises data protection through appropriate technical measures, including encryption for data transmission. Whilst not explicitly mandating SSL certificates, GDPR’s security requirements make encryption practically necessary for organisations processing personal data online.

Healthcare organisations subject to HIPAA regulations must implement safeguards for protected health information transmission. SSL certificates provide essential encryption for web-based healthcare applications and communication systems handling patient data.

Financial services regulations often include specific encryption requirements for customer data and transaction protection. SSL certificates form part of comprehensive security frameworks required for regulatory compliance in banking and financial service environments.

Industry-specific standards may impose additional requirements for certificate management, validation levels, or cryptographic strengths. Understanding applicable standards helps ensure implementation meets all relevant requirements whilst avoiding compliance gaps.

Future Developments in SSL Technology

The SSL certificate landscape continues evolving with technological advances, changing threat landscapes, and enhanced security requirements. Understanding emerging trends helps organisations prepare for future requirements whilst making informed decisions about current implementations.

Quantum computing represents a long-term challenge for current cryptographic methods, potentially requiring migration to quantum-resistant encryption algorithms. Whilst practical quantum threats remain distant, organisations should monitor developments and prepare for eventual cryptographic transitions.

Certificate transparency systems continue expanding, providing enhanced visibility into certificate issuance activities and improving detection of unauthorised certificates. These systems help identify potential security incidents whilst providing accountability for certificate authority operations.

Automated certificate management protocols, such as ACME (Automatic Certificate Management Environment), simplify certificate lifecycle management through standardised automation interfaces. These protocols enable seamless integration with various platforms and services whilst reducing manual management overhead.

Enhanced validation methods may emerge to address limitations of current validation techniques whilst providing improved security assurance. Developments in identity verification and authentication technologies could enhance certificate authority validation capabilities.

Integration with emerging technologies such as HTTP/3, edge computing, and serverless architectures will require adaptations in certificate management approaches. Understanding these technological trends helps organisations prepare for implementation challenges and opportunities.

Troubleshooting Common SSL Issues

Effective SSL certificate troubleshooting requires systematic approaches to identify and resolve various issues that may arise during implementation or operation. Understanding common problems and their solutions enables rapid resolution and minimises service disruption.

Browser warnings indicate various potential issues, from expired certificates to configuration problems or security vulnerabilities. Interpreting these warnings correctly helps identify root causes and appropriate remediation actions. Modern browsers provide detailed error information that can guide troubleshooting efforts.

Certificate validation errors often stem from incomplete certificate chains, incorrect certificate installation, or certificate authority recognition issues. Verification tools can identify chain problems and provide guidance for resolving validation failures.

Performance issues may arise from excessive cryptographic overhead, inefficient cipher selections, or configuration problems that impact connection establishment. Optimising SSL configurations can improve performance whilst maintaining security effectiveness.

Compatibility problems with older browsers or systems may require adjustments to cipher suites, protocol versions, or certificate configurations. Balancing security requirements with compatibility needs requires careful consideration of supported client capabilities.

Renewal and expiry issues require proactive monitoring and systematic renewal processes to prevent service disruption. Automated monitoring tools can provide advance warning of approaching expiry dates and validation problems.

SSL Certificate Best Practices

Implementing SSL certificates effectively requires adherence to established best practices that ensure security, reliability, and maintainability. These practices reflect industry experience and help organisations avoid common pitfalls whilst maximising security benefits.

Certificate lifecycle management encompasses planning, procurement, installation, monitoring, and renewal activities in systematic workflows. Establishing clear procedures for each lifecycle phase ensures consistent management and prevents oversights that could compromise security.

Security configuration hardening involves implementing strong cipher suites, disabling obsolete protocols, and configuring security headers that enhance protection against various attack vectors. Regular configuration reviews help maintain security effectiveness as threats evolve.

Monitoring and alerting systems provide visibility into certificate health, expiry dates, and potential security issues. Automated monitoring reduces manual oversight requirements whilst ensuring timely responses to problems.

Documentation and training ensure that relevant personnel understand SSL certificate concepts, procedures, and troubleshooting techniques. Well-documented procedures facilitate consistent implementation and enable effective incident response.

Regular security assessments validate SSL configurations against current best practices and identify potential improvements. Third-party assessment tools can provide objective evaluation of security posture and configuration effectiveness.

Key Takeaways

SSL certificates represent essential security infrastructure for modern web applications, providing encryption, authentication, and integrity verification for online communications. Proper implementation requires understanding certificate types, validation levels, and configuration requirements that match organisational needs.

Certificate selection should balance security requirements, budget constraints, and management complexity. Domain Validated certificates provide basic protection at low cost, whilst Extended Validation certificates offer maximum assurance for high-security applications.

Installation and configuration require attention to technical details including certificate formats, private key management, and certificate chain completeness. Server-specific procedures vary considerably, making understanding of platform requirements essential for successful implementation.

Ongoing management encompasses monitoring, renewal planning, and lifecycle management activities that prevent service disruption and maintain security effectiveness. Automated systems can reduce management overhead whilst improving reliability.

Advanced configuration techniques including HSTS, certificate pinning, and Perfect Forward Secrecy provide enhanced security for organisations requiring additional protection against sophisticated attacks.

Compliance considerations increasingly mandate SSL certificate implementation for organisations handling sensitive data. Understanding applicable requirements ensures compliance whilst avoiding potential penalties or audit failures.

Future developments including quantum computing, certificate transparency, and automated management protocols will continue shaping SSL certificate requirements. Staying informed about these trends helps organisations prepare for future needs whilst optimising current implementations.

Troubleshooting capabilities enable rapid resolution of common issues including browser warnings, validation errors, and performance problems. Systematic approaches to problem identification and resolution minimise service disruption whilst maintaining security effectiveness.

Best practices encompassing lifecycle management, security hardening, monitoring, and regular assessment ensure optimal SSL certificate implementation that provides robust protection whilst remaining manageable and cost-effective.

Summary

SSL certificates have evolved from optional security enhancements to essential components of modern web infrastructure, providing critical protection for online communications through encryption, authentication, and integrity verification. This comprehensive guide has explored all aspects of SSL certificate implementation, from basic concepts to advanced configuration techniques.

Understanding certificate types enables appropriate selection based on security requirements and validation needs. Domain Validated certificates offer cost-effective basic protection, Organisation Validated certificates provide enhanced credibility for business applications, and Extended Validation certificates deliver maximum assurance for high-security environments. Wildcard and multi-domain certificates provide flexible solutions for complex requirements.

Proper implementation requires careful attention to validation processes, installation procedures, and ongoing management activities. Certificate authorities employ various validation methods to verify domain ownership and organisational legitimacy, with more secure certificates requiring comprehensive verification procedures.

Installation challenges including mixed content issues, certificate chain problems, and compatibility requirements can be addressed through systematic troubleshooting and adherence to best practices. Advanced configuration techniques such as HSTS implementation, certificate pinning, and Perfect Forward Secrecy provide enhanced protection for security-conscious organisations.

Cost considerations vary significantly based on certificate type, features, and provider selection. Organisations can optimise costs through careful needs analysis and provider comparison whilst ensuring adequate security coverage for their requirements.

Compliance requirements increasingly mandate SSL certificate implementation across various industries and regulatory frameworks. Understanding applicable requirements ensures compliance whilst providing necessary protection for sensitive data transmission.

Future developments including quantum computing challenges, enhanced automation, and evolving technologies will continue shaping SSL certificate requirements. Organisations benefit from staying informed about these trends whilst focusing on current implementation needs and proven security practices.

Success with SSL certificates ultimately depends on systematic planning, proper implementation, and ongoing management that maintains security effectiveness whilst supporting business objectives and regulatory compliance requirements.